Latest Patents
One of Qualls' latest patents is for a method of manufacturing magnetic recording tape. This invention involves applying a front coat that includes a magnetic component to a substrate, resulting in a coated substrate with distinct faces. An abrasive surface is then used to remove material from the corners of the coated substrate at a non-orthogonal angle, enhancing the manufacturing process. Another significant patent is for an air-operated device designed to secure cargo onto a vehicle. This adjustable latching device features elongated rails with slots and a flexible fastening member that can be tightened remotely, allowing for efficient load management.
